Proteomics
Proteomic research applications for magnetic resonance range from the determination of structures of large biomolecules, to the analysis of metabolic processes in organisms and much more. Protein structure determination by NMR has established itself as a major player in the area of Structural Genomics/Biology. In the fields of metabonomics/ metabolomics NMR methods provide the researcher with an unprecedented richness of information.
